Barack Obama has personal experience with poverty and the growing income gap, having grown up abroad in Indonesia and working as a community organizer in the south side of Chicago. 2. After graduating Harvard Law, Magna Cum Laude and president of the Harvard Law Review, Obama could have become a wealthy corporate or trial lawyer but returned to Chicago to practice civil rights law. 3. He also taught Constitutional Law at the University of Chicago, so he knows how our government is supposed to work. 4. (Removed as it was applicable only to the Democratic nominatin process) 5. He opposed the Iraq war before it started and has a specific plan for redeploying all combat troops ...(within sixteen months). (Edited as the original date, based on a sixteen-month schedule, has had "implementation-slide". 6. He has received an A+ score from the Genocide Intervention Network for being a "champion" and taking crucial action to end the genocide in Darfur, co-sponsoring and voting for all significant Darfur legislation. 7. Barack Obama is committed to universal health care by the end of his first term. 8. (I removed this one from Smyth's list because I don't happen to view it as a good thing.) 9. He has ... not accepted PAC money and is the least compromised by big money special interests. 10. has the intellect, natural talent and charisma to communicate effectively to the entire world, bring people together, change the status quo and move our country forward.
